The Cotton Satin Fabric - White Satin is a soft-to-the-touch satin fabric, with a weight of 168 gr/m2 and a width of 150 cm. It is made of 100% cotton, which makes it comfortable and breathable.
The printed design is pictorial and abstract in style, with vibrant colors such as reddish-orange, dark, and night black, representing 40.38%, 34.93%, and 10.06% of the design, respectively. The print features abstract shapes and geometric lines, creating an artistic and drawn style.
This fabric is printed with the design on one side using digital textile printing. It is important to note that it is not a double-sided printed fabric, but rather printed on one side.
In terms of its general characteristics, the fabric has a soft and thin texture, which makes it pleasant to the touch. The printed design adds a touch of color and dynamism, making it an ideal option for fashion garments such as shirts, dresses, and skirts. It can also be used in home textiles, such as pillowcases and sheets.
Regarding colors that could combine with this design, plain colors such as white, black, and gold can be used to highlight and complement the main colors of the print.
As for care, it is recommended to wash the fabric at a maximum temperature of 30ºC and not use bleach. It can be ironed at a warm temperature and dry cleaned, except with trichloroethylene. It can also be tumble dried at a reduced temperature.
The printing technology used to manufacture this fabric is reactive direct digital printing for natural fibers. This technique ensures durable and vibrant print quality, and allows the design to be permanently fixed on the fabric.
